Where light and darkness meet, let's begin Chanukah together in a community-wide gathering.
IGNITE! opens with an intergenerational, songful candle-lighting, then breaks into a choose-your-own-adventure of arts-based workshops, performances and Jewish study sessions. Throughout the night, enjoy short concerts inspired by the themes of the season, curated by the Ashkenaz Festival. Come early or late, stay a little or stay the whole time!
Kosher food for purchase.
The Family/Kid's Track admission provides access to the inter-generational communal candle-lighting at 6:00 p.m. and to a shorter program for families with kids ages 5 to 12, with a light kosher dinner included.
